Job DescriptionWe are looking for an enthusiastic and highly motivated Customer Service Specialist to work within our Lettings Department in Annesley. As a Customer Service Specialist , you will provide tenancy support services to branches, landlords and tenants.What's in it for you as a Customer Service Specialist
  • Get full training and development
  • A good understanding of estate agency business
  • Fast paced, fun environment
  • Regular team meetings
  • Full company briefings
  • A career pathway
Key responsibilities of a Customer Service Specialist
  • Act as a central point of contact managing the effective resolution of queries from clients and staff
  • Assisting customers with general tenancy queries
  • Dealing promptly and courteously to communication with landlord, tenants, and internal partners
  • Providing a first-class service to maximise customer retention
  • Ensuring personal and team deadlines are met, service levels maintained and KPI’s achieved
Skills and Experience required to be successful as a Customer Service Specialist
  • Strong customer service skills and confident communicator
  • Good team player
  • Ability to stay calm under pressure
  • Excellent negotiation and influencing skills
  • Excellent planning and organisational skills
  • Good analytical ability
Benefits for a Customer Service Specialist
  • Aviva Digicare + workplace / Car leasing and cycle to work scheme
  • Colleague discount scheme / Perks at work / Gym discounts
  • Life assurance / Workplace pension scheme
